HoverStare is an AI code review bot for GitHub pull requests, written in Rust and shipped as a single static binary that runs as a GitHub Action. Instead of tossing a diff at a model in one shot, its reviewer reads your repository like a human reviewer would — opening context files, grepping call sites, comparing against the base branch — before it says anything. A multi-pass vote plus an independent verifier keeps false positives down, and every finding it reports is tracked across commits until it's fixed.

Why HoverStare?

  • 🔍 Repo-aware, not diff-only. The reviewing model gets a read-only tool set (read_file / grep / glob / show_base_file) and uses it to verify suspicions before reporting. It catches bugs that hide outside the diff — like a changed function whose callers break two files away.
  • 🗳️ Multi-pass voting + verifier. Three independent review passes (correctness / concurrency / security lenses) vote on findings; lone-vote findings must survive an independent verifier pass with tool access. High signal, low noise.
  • 📌 Precise inline comments. Line numbers are validated against the real diff and snapped to the nearest valid anchor, so comments land exactly where the bug is — never on the wrong line.
  • 🔁 Incremental reviews. Push a fix and HoverStare reviews only the delta, marks fixed findings as resolved (or leaves a "✅ confirmed fixed" note), and never repeats itself.
  • 🛡️ Fail-open by design. Network trouble, rate limits, or a flaky model will never block your CI.
  • 🔑 BYOK. Bring your own key: Anthropic, or any OpenAI-compatible endpoint (Kimi, DeepSeek, OpenRouter, …). Code goes straight to your provider.

Every inline comment carries a hidden fingerprint (path + code line + title hash). On the next push, HoverStare diffs against its previous review, asks the model which open findings are fixed, and resolves those threads — immune to line-number drift.

Repository instructions

HoverStare reads repo-level rule files and applies them to reviews (they supplement but never override the built-in core rules). Precedence:

  1. hoverstare.md / .hoverstare.md / .hoverstare/*.md / .github/hoverstare.md
  2. AGENTS.md
  3. .github/copilot-instructions.md, CLAUDE.md, .cursorrules

Files are read from the base branch (a PR editing AGENTS.md cannot inject instructions). Core safety rules (read-only tools, targeted verification, defect-only scope, JSON contract) can never be overridden.

Optional: brand identity (posts as your own bot)

By default, reviews post as github-actions[bot] — that's a GITHUB_TOKEN limitation, and it's the recommended mode for most users (zero extra setup).

Want a branded bot identity? Register your own GitHub App (5 minutes, no server needed — token exchange happens inside GitHub Actions) and pass its credentials to the action:

  1. Create a GitHub App at Settings → Developer settings → GitHub Apps (webhook off; permissions: contents read, pull-requests write, issues write, commit statuses write), install it on your repo
  2. Add its App ID and private key as secrets APP_ID / APP_PRIVATE_KEY
  3. Pass them:
      - uses: liuchong/hoverstare@v0.0.5
        with:
          app_id: ${{ secrets.APP_ID }}
          app_private_key: ${{ secrets.APP_PRIVATE_KEY }}

Reviews then post as your-app-name[bot], and resolveReviewThread works without the GITHUB_TOKEN limitation (no GH_PAT needed).

Zero-config hoverstare[bot] identity for everyone is on the roadmap as an optional self-hostable hoverstare serve webhook service.

Develop mode: issues & PRs as your AI IDE

HoverStare can also develop — issues and PRs become a conversation-driven development environment (spec 11/12). Not automation glue that reacts to events: a place where you actually build the feature, end to end, in the open.

How a feature flows

Issue mainline — file an issue mentioning @hoverstare:

  1. It investigates the repo and replies with an analysis + plan (in comments).
  2. Discuss by simply replying; each round is answered in the thread.
  3. @hoverstare go — it creates a branch, implements, pushes, and opens a PR (with Closes #N).

PR mainline — on any same-repo PR:

  • @hoverstare <instruction> — it checks out the PR branch, develops, commits (Conventional Commits, authored as hoverstare[bot]), pushes back to the branch, and reports in a comment. Rounds that exhaust their budget self-continue (max 10 rounds per PR).
  • Humans can adjust by committing to the branch directly — the next round always syncs to the remote head first and never overwrites your commits.
  • @hoverstare merge — once checks are green and there are no conflicts, it squash-merges and deletes the source branch.

Setup

  1. Workflow: add the issues and pull_request_review triggers and grant contents: write + issues: write. .github/workflows/hoverstare.yml in this repo is a complete working example.
  2. Tokens (two duties, two tokens):
    • Identity (comments, reviews, opening PRs): the default GITHUB_TOKEN, or a GitHub App token for the hoverstare[bot] identity.
    • Write operations (git push, merge, branch deletion): a PAT via the gh_pat input, or an App with contents: write. Pushes made with the default GITHUB_TOKEN do not trigger CI, so required checks would never run on bot commits.
  3. Permissions (optional): declare who can use what in .github/hoverstare.toml — see spec 12. Defaults: auto-review for anyone, @review/develop for collaborators, merge for users with write access.

Notes

  • Only repo collaborators can issue commands; fork PRs are out of scope.
  • PRs opened by the bot may hold CI in action_required state until approved, depending on your repo's Actions approval policy (first-time contributors).
  • Large tasks are sliced into budgeted rounds; the bot self-continues (max 10 rounds per PR). It cannot run builds or tests — CI failures are relayed back as instructions for the next round.

FAQ

Reviews/comments fail with permission errors? Check workflow permissions (pull-requests: write required) and repo Settings → Actions → General → Workflow permissions is "Read and write".

"model not found"? You configured an OpenAI-compatible endpoint but no model name. Set HOVERSTARE_MODEL (or model in hoverstare.toml).

400 / invalid temperature? Your endpoint only accepts the default temperature. Set set_temperature = false in hoverstare.toml.

Fixed findings aren't getting resolved? A GitHub platform limitation: the default GITHUB_TOKEN cannot call resolveReviewThread. HoverStare falls back to a "✅ confirmed fixed" reply in the thread. For full resolution, store a classic PAT (repo scope) as secret GH_PAT and pass it in the workflow env.

GitHub Enterprise? Set GITHUB_API_URL=https://<your-ghe-host>/api/v3.

@hoverstare merge fails with 403? The merge endpoint needs contents: write. Pass a PAT via gh_pat, or grant the GitHub App Contents: Read and write (and accept the upgrade on the installation).

CI on the bot's PR sits at action_required? That's GitHub's approval policy for outside/first-time contributors. Approve the runs once, or relax it under Settings → Actions → General → Fork pull request workflows.

A go/dev round says "no changes, no PR created"? Usually the task was too vague for one budgeted round. Reply with a sharper, smaller instruction (files to touch, acceptance criteria) and run go again — see the bot's comment for what it actually did.
